Brillion waltzed into their contest on Saturday with three straight wins... but they left with four. They enjoyed a cozy 57-42 win over the Wrightstown Tigers. That's more bragging rights for the Lions, who also won the pair's last head-to-head.
Brillion's victory bumped their record up to 5-1. As for Wrightstown, their loss dropped their record down to 3-2.
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Brillion will have some time to savor their win since their next game is a little ways off: they'll take on Seymour at 1:40 p.m. on December 27th. As for Wrightstown, a feisty cat fight will be fought when the Wrightstown Tigers take on the Oconto Falls Panthers at 7:00 p.m. on January 31, 2025.
